The Sustainability Office is planning another Zero Waste Week during October 16th to October 20th. This event is aimed at building a culture of reducing and diverting waste throughout campus.

Climate change is the pre-eminent global issue of our time, yet many of us still struggle to find the right language, time and place to talk about it. Beyond Crisis is a 1-hour film that models a constructive dialogue on climate change, with over 50 diverse voices spread over 5 chapters.
